Guthrie Family Tartan WR1085
|

|
| From the Barony of Guthrie in Angus, the name is also
said to derive from Guthrum, a Scandinavian prince. Sir
David Guthrie was King's Treasurer in the fifteenth
century and built Guthrie Castle near Friockheim, Angus,
in 1468.
